## In short

Jeonju House is a Korean restaurant in Bongmyeong-dong, Yuseong, Daejeon, serving fresh pork belly grilled on a cast-iron pot lid and galbi kimchi stew cooked in a cauldron. After a lunch of galbi kimchi stew and rolled egg on an earlier visit, the writer came back for dinner with her husband and ordered two servings of the cast-iron-lid pork belly at ₩16,000 each, then added a third serving after one bite because the cuts were as thick as five-layer pork belly. For thick-cut pork belly with aged kimchi, Jeonju House is the answer.

## What side dishes come with it, and the self-refill corner

Let's take a look at the side dish lineup~ Pan-fried tofu, braised pollack, salad, stir-fried seaweed stems, braised potatoes, pickled onions, seasoned eggplant, white wood-ear mushrooms, watery kimchi, aged kimchi, lettuce and peppers, and fresh chive salad — all these appetizing side dishes come out one after another. The seasoning is just right and they pair really well with the meat.

If you want more of any side dish, you can just use the self-refill corner. Feel free to refill as much as you like. Bean sprouts weren't part of the basic side dishes, but they were at the self-refill corner, so I grabbed some to grill together with the pork belly :)
